The Livelihood Development Services Unit (LDSU) aims to develop and enhance the local economy especially in the grassroots communities. The unit assists micro entrepreneurs in the establishment and/or expansion of livelihood ventures that will boost economic activity, generate productivity and provide employment opportunities.
By managing its Financial Assistance Program (FAP), LDSU extends financial and technical assistance to small entrepreneurs through its various loan windows:
- Project Loans for Micro-entrepreneurs - business loan scheme for small-medium entrepreneurs
- Area-Based financial scheme -production assistance for people’s organizations and assisted community participants
- Social Credit scheme for low income disadvantaged entrepreneurs
- Transport Service Loan for tricycle drivers
All clients who qualified of the assistance are provided opportunity to attend seminars and training workshops customized to enhance their business management skills, e.g. capacity building, basic financial management training, project management training.
The training program is conducted in partnership with the University of the Philippines-Institute for Small Scale Industries (UP-ISSI).
